]> git.droids-corp.org - dpdk.git/blobdiff - examples/fips_validation/fips_validation_tdes.c
examples/ipsec-secgw: add default flow for inline Rx
[dpdk.git] / examples / fips_validation / fips_validation_tdes.c
index 2b262c9a0298f1abbdf8b1c7859e4d3e19a29a0d..5b6737643ac017c80c7267c5559c2af926b59860 100644 (file)
@@ -12,6 +12,7 @@
 
 #define NEW_LINE_STR   "#"
 #define TEST_TYPE_KEY  " for CBC"
+#define TEST_TYPE_ECB_KEY      " for ECB"
 #define TEST_CBCI_KEY  " for CBCI"
 
 #define ENC_STR                "[ENCRYPT]"
@@ -252,6 +253,12 @@ parse_test_tdes_init(void)
                        if (strstr(line, test_types[j].desc)) {
                                info.interim_info.tdes_data.test_type =
                                                test_types[j].type;
+                               if (strstr(line, TEST_TYPE_ECB_KEY))
+                                       info.interim_info.tdes_data.test_mode =
+                                               TDES_MODE_ECB;
+                               else
+                                       info.interim_info.tdes_data.test_mode =
+                                               TDES_MODE_CBC;
                                break;
                        }
        }